
Wow! Just wow. Your signatures and your comments to the WA State Parks & Recreation Commission, opposing the militarization of Washington State Parks, are making a huge difference. Thank you so much.
Because of your emails, and letters and postcards, a special public meeting has now been scheduled on May 6th in Pt. Townsend where WA-PRC Commissioners will hear from the public. We will update you with the time when we know it. We expect it to be around 6 pm. Yes, we need you to be there. Or if you live out of the area, we need you to send a friend to be there representing you. Cards, letters, emails are great. Physical bodies in the chairs will amplify the message. So make plans to be there. (Whidbey residents: walk on at Keystone. Rides are being organized to Ft. Worden on Pt. Townsend side.)
And, on March 12th, at a regular meeting of the Parks Commission in Chelan, the Navy proposal will be presented to commissioners at 12:45 pm. A Webex streaming link has been published.
